Exterior ACE powder coatings are engineered to survive decades of UV exposure, mechanical abuse, and corrosion in harsh outdoor conditions. Unlike many general‑purpose coatings, ACE‑grade powders are formulated with high‑performance resins, robust pigments, and advanced additives that target three pillars of performance: [ulprospector.ul]
- UV and color stability over long service life. [paint]
- Corrosion protection on complex geometries and edges. [paint]
- Mechanical durability under impact, abrasion, and frequent cleaning. [tiger-coatings]

A recurring theme in ACE exterior applications is the dominance of super durable polyester and hyper durable fluoropolymer powder coatings. [shop.interpon]
Super durable polyester systems (including TGIC and TGIC‑free technologies) are widely recognized as the workhorse for exterior ACE metal substrates. These formulations offer: [ulprospector.ul]
- Excellent gloss retention and color stability under strong UV.
- Good over‑bake resistance, which is essential in complex production environments. [shop.interpon]
- Tough, thick films with reliable edge coverage on welded and formed parts. [paint]
Global brands such as AkzoNobel's Interpon series have demonstrated that polyester TGIC powder coatings can deliver outstanding exterior durability for agricultural and construction equipment, architectural frames and other long‑life outdoor applications. [shop.interpon]
Where extreme UV exposure, color fidelity and long‑term aesthetics are non‑negotiable—for example, coastal structures, high‑end architecture or signature brand colors on ACE fleets—hyper durable fluoropolymer powders are increasingly used. [paint]
These technologies:
- Maintain gloss and color over very long exposure cycles in aggressive climates.
- Offer exceptional resistance to chalking, fading and chemical attack. [tiger-coatings]
- Support extended warranty periods and lower total lifecycle cost for asset owners. [ulprospector.ul]
From my experience working with ACE projects, fluoropolymer systems often justify their higher material cost by reducing the frequency of repainting and the risk of early aesthetic failure on flagship equipment or façade components. [paint]

Recent technical developments in powder coating technology have a direct impact on exterior ACE applications. [pfonline]
Low‑temperature curing powder coatings are gaining momentum as OEMs push for energy savings and CO₂ reductions. New polyester and hybrid systems can cure at temperatures as low as 80–135 °C, enabling: [pfonline]
- Lower oven energy consumption and faster line speeds. [pfonline]
- Coating of heat‑sensitive substrates, such as certain plastics and composites, increasingly used in modern ACE equipment. [ulprospector.ul]
For manufacturers operating in markets with rising energy costs, this shift directly influences total finishing line economics. [abnewswire]
Thin‑film powder coatings, designed for film thicknesses around 30–60 µm, deliver comparable protection and aesthetics with less material usage. At the same time, powder‑on‑powder systems allow ACE components to be coated with multiple layers without intermediate curing, improving corrosion protection and film properties while minimizing energy consumption. [paint]
There is growing interest in functional powders for ACE and related infrastructure:
- Anti‑graffiti powder coatings help reduce cleaning costs for equipment and public installations exposed to vandalism. [pfonline]
- Antimicrobial formulations are increasingly specified for medical equipment, food processing machinery and public‑touch surfaces, aligning with stricter hygiene requirements. [paint]
These functional layers often sit on top of super durable bases, creating multi‑property systems tailored to specific use cases. [paint]
Sustainability has become central to powder coating innovation. Modern ACE powders are formulated with zero VOCs, minimal hazardous air pollutants (HAPs) and, in some cases, resins derived from recycled plastics. Examples include polyester resins based on recycled PET, which reduce reliance on virgin fossil feedstocks. [ulprospector.ul]
These developments align closely with the broader market shift towards environmental accountability and circular economy principles. [paint]

Choosing the right powder coating for exterior ACE applications requires a structured evaluation of performance, process and sustainability factors. [tiger-coatings]
When specifying an ACE exterior powder, consider:
1. Resin chemistry and durability class (super durable polyester vs hyper durable fluoropolymer). [shop.interpon]
2. Gloss retention and color stability based on recognized test standards.
3. Corrosion resistance, including edge coverage and resistance on complex welds. [shop.interpon]
4. Mechanical properties: impact, flexibility and abrasion resistance under real‑world conditions. [tiger-coatings]
Equally important are:
- Curing temperature and cycle time, which affect oven sizing and energy usage. [pfonline]
- Compatibility with existing application equipment and pretreatment lines.
- Potential for powder‑on‑powder systems to reduce processing steps. [paint]
- Material utilization rates and reclaim strategies in high‑volume ACE operations. [pfonline]

The table below summarizes how exterior ACE powder coatings compare with other typical coating approaches in demanding outdoor environments. [tiger-coatings]
| Aspect | ACE exterior powder coatings | Liquid coatings | Anodizing |
|---|---|---|---|
| Durability | High UV and corrosion resistance for long‑life outdoor use (tiger-coatings) | Variable; often needs more frequent repainting (paint) | Excellent for certain aluminum substrates, limited for steel (paint) |
| Environmental profile | VOC‑free, minimal HAPs, recyclable overspray (ulprospector.ul) | Solvent‑borne systems with VOC emissions (paint) | Electrochemical process, different environmental considerations (paint) |
| Film properties | Thick, uniform films with good edge coverage (shop.interpon) | Thinner films; sag and run risk on complex geometries (paint) | Hard, thin oxide layer; not easily reparable (paint) |
| Aesthetic flexibility | Wide color and texture range, including metallic and effect finishes (ulprospector.ul) | Broad color range but with variable consistency (paint) | More limited palette and texture options (paint) |
| Process efficiency | Highly automated, reclaimable, compatible with powder‑on‑powder systems (paint) | More manual operations, higher solvent handling requirements (paint) | Specialized equipment and substrate restrictions (paint) |

Q1: What are ACE applications in the context of powder coatings?
ACE refers to agricultural, construction and earthmoving equipment, as well as related heavy‑duty outdoor machinery and components that require long‑life, high‑durability protective finishes. [powdercoatings.brand.akzonobel]
Q2: Why are super durable polyester powders recommended for exterior ACE use?
Super durable polyester powders deliver excellent UV resistance, color stability and mechanical robustness, making them a proven choice for long‑term outdoor exposure on steel and aluminum substrates. [shop.interpon]
Q3: When should fluoropolymer powders be used instead of polyester?
Fluoropolymer powders are preferred when extreme UV exposure, very long warranty periods or strict aesthetic requirements demand maximum gloss and color retention beyond standard super durable systems. [tiger-coatings]
Q4: How do eco‑friendly powder coatings support sustainability goals?
Eco‑friendly powder coatings are solvent‑free, VOC‑free and often incorporate recycled or bio‑based raw materials, helping manufacturers minimize emissions and align with environmental regulations and corporate sustainability targets. [pfonline]
